Metal

Traditional metal braces are made from durable, high-quality stainless steel. They are sleeker and more comfortable than the braces 20 and even ten years ago.

Metal Braces, also called brackets, are the most common type of appliance in orthodontic treatment.

  • With advancements in materials and design, metal brackets are durable and more comfortable than ever before.
  • Metal brackets are bonded to the front of each tooth and act as anchors holding the archwire in place.
  • Elastic ligatures are placed around each bracket to secure the archwire in place. Colorful elastic ligatures can be chosen at each appointment.

They use force to move your teeth gradually:

  • Metal brackets are bonded to the teeth with a special adhesive
  • Archwires will be placed through the brackets to apply pressure on the teeth, which moves them to the desired position
  • Adjustments are periodically made to ensure teeth are shifting correctly and leading to a healthy, straight smile

At Joosse Family Orthodontics, we emphasize the following tips to ensure the best possible outcome:

  • Brush teeth twice daily and floss every day
  • Supplement with a fluoride mouth rinse (Listerine Total Care or ACT mouth rinse are two good examples)
  • Avoid sugary and acidic foods/beverages
  • Keep your six-month checkups with your dentist for professional cleanings and check for decay
  • Take care of your appliances!
  • Follow instructions, especially with rubber bands!

The effort you put into taking good care of your teeth during orthodontic treatment will directly affect your smile results. Good oral hygiene habits will also last a lifetime.

Ceramic

Clear braces are like traditional metal ones, except that the brackets are clear or tooth-colored to blend in with your smile and deliver less noticeable treatment.

Clear braces work the same way as metal options but offer a cosmetic alternative to metal.

  • Brackets and archwires mimic the color of the teeth or are clear.
  • Ceramic material is more brittle than metal and can discolor and break more easily than metal orthodontics.
  • Ceramic offers a more discreet way to align your smile!

Clear braces use the same method as traditional metal to straighten your teeth.

  • Ceramic, tooth-colored or clear brackets are bonded to the teeth with a special adhesive
  • Archwires will be placed through the brackets to apply pressure on the teeth, which moves them to the desired position
  • Adjustments are periodically made to ensure teeth are shifting correctly and leading to a healthy, straight smile
  • Hard to notice: Since ceramic can be color-matched to your natural teeth, they are difficult to notice at a distance.

LightForce braces are the latest technology in orthodontics. They are clear and are 3D printed, so they are 100% customized to the patient’s tooth size/shape.

Braces are no longer one-size-fits-all! LightForce braces are 100% customized to each patient’s tooth shape.

LightForce braces are clear and 3D printed. Like Invisalign, Dr. Joosse prescribes the tooth movements, and then the brackets are printed exactly to Dr. Joosse’s prescription. The end result is both faster and more accurate treatment! Not only is treatment faster, but the number of visits required to complete treatment is less, meaning less missed school or work!

  • More Efficient Treatment – Reduce treatment time by an average of 37%.
  • Fewer appointments – Customized to your teeth and your prescription, so fewer adjustments and fewer appointments at the office.
  • Patient comfort– Low profile with highly contoured edges and smooth tie-wings made with a polycrystalline material instead of metal.
  • Discreet– LightForce brackets are tooth-colored, providing you with a discreet treatment from start to finish
